Celluloid Verdict
A generational tearjerker of rare craft — Baeksang's Best Drama and the highest-rated Korean series in IMDb history, it earns every tear through patient writing and two of K-drama's finest lead performances.

What is When Life Gives You Tangerines about?
Beginning in 1960s Jeju, a defiant haenyeo's daughter with a poet's heart and the steadfast boy who loves her build a life together across four decades of hardship, loss and stubborn tenderness. Written by Lim Sang-choon and directed by Kim Won-seok, the sixteen-part saga hands its leads to IU and Park Bo-gum in youth and Moon So-ri and Park Hae-joon in age, folding one family's small victories into the sweep of modern Korean history — a chronicle of ordinary devotion told season by season, like fruit ripening against the wind.

When Life Gives You Tangerines Review: A Lifetime on Jeju, Rendered in Full
★★★★½
When Life Gives You Tangerines follows one couple across the decades on Jeju Island and earns every tear it draws — a generational epic in which IU and Park Bo-gum give two of the finest K-drama performances in recent memory.
Essential viewing, and not only for K-drama fans. Bring tissues, clear your weekend, and let it take its time — the patience is the point.
